visual threshold

1. the minimum level of stimulation that can be detected visually.

2. any of the thresholds for detecting various aspects of visual stimulation, including intensity, resolution, contrast sensitivity, movement acuities, position acuities, and so on.

manoptoscope

n. a hollow cone used for measuring eye dominance. The observer views a small target by placing the base of the cone near the eyes and then viewing the target through the small end of the cone while closing first one eye and then the other. The eye through which the target is actually seen is the dominant eye.
